Telangana Govt Plans to Construct 3 Lakh Houses in Next Five Years

25 Apr, 2018 19:34 IST
IT and Industries Minister KT Rama Rao

Jagtial: Telangana industries and IT minister KT Rama Rao that their government was planning to construct three lakh double bedroom houses in the next five years. Speaking on the occasion of laying foundation stone for construction houses near hear, the minister said the housing scheme implemented by Telangana was the largest in the country.

The minister was participating the in the function held to market the construction of 4,160 double bedroom houses taken up at the cost Rs 230 crore at Nukapalli. KTR said that the government had already announced construction of 2.72 lakh houses and now another three lakh houses would be added to it. In total the government would be spending Rs 18,000 crore for the housing scheme.

Recalling the former united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ister N Kiran Kumar Reddy's words that Telangana would plunge into darkness after bifurcation, KTR said that their government has proved him to be wrong by providing 24 hours power supply to the farm sector.

KTR promised all-round development of Jagtial. Very soon Jagtial would have food processing units, he asserted and added that local unemployed people will find employment in these units.
